vorbisgain - Adds tags to Ogg Vorbis files to adjust the volume

Description:
VorbisGain is a utility that uses a psychoacoustic method to correct the
volume of an Ogg Vorbis file to a predefined standardized loudness.

It needs player support to work. Non-supporting players will play back
the files without problems, but you'll miss out on the benefits.
Nowadays most good players such as ogg123, xmms and mplayer are already
compatible.
